The following information lists the population statistics and breakdown for the 38917 zip code. The total population is 3832, of which, 1993 are male and 1839 are female. With a total area of 430.882 square miles, the population density is 6.8 people per square mile. The median age of the population is 42.9 years old. The median inflation-adjusted family income in the 38917 zip code is $68968. This is -13.23% less than the national average. This income places 12.1% of the population below the poverty line. The average retirement income for individuals in this zip code (for those that have it) is $30216. In the 38917 zip code, 89.1% of individuals over 25 years old have a high school degree or higher, and 19% have a bachelors degree or higher. In the 38917 zip, there are an estimated 1442 people in the labor force, of which, 1333 are employed, and 109 are unemployed. There are a total of 0 people in the armed forces. The average commute time for this zip code is 29.3 minutes. Of the total people that work, 55 worked from home and 1333 commuted. The average number of hours worked is 40.4. The median home value for the 38917 zip code is 103800. There is an estimated  1314 number of occupied housing units, the median gross rent in is $806 per month, and the average monthly housing costs are estimated to be $585.
